Making MSI Afterburner Permanent: Ensuring It Starts With Your System
Making MSI Afterburner permanent is crucial if you want to ensure your GPU optimization settings are always applied whenever you start your system. By configuring the software to launch at startup, you won’t have to manually open it every time you power on your computer.
To make MSI Afterburner permanent, follow these steps:
1. Open MSI Afterburner.
2. Click on the Settings icon at the bottom-right corner of the window.
3. In the Settings window, navigate to the General tab.
4. Check the “Start with Windows” box.
5. Click on the “Apply” button to save the changes.
By enabling this option, MSI Afterburner will automatically start up whenever you turn on your computer, ensuring that all your preferred GPU optimization settings are in place right from the beginning. This way, you can avoid any unnecessary loss of performance due to forgetting to launch the software manually.

Overclocking With MSI Afterburner: Maximizing GPU Power
Overclocking your GPU can unlock its true potential, allowing you to squeeze out extra performance and improve gaming experiences. MSI Afterburner offers powerful tools to help you achieve higher clock speeds and boost your GPU’s capabilities.
To begin overclocking with MSI Afterburner, start by increasing the core clock, which determines the frequency at which the GPU operates. Incrementally raise the core clock by small increments, around 10-15 MHz at a time, and test for stability using stress-testing tools like FurMark or 3DMark. Keep an eye on the temperatures and ensure they stay within safe limits.
Once you’ve found your stable core clock, move on to the memory clock. Similarly, increase it in small steps, testing for stability each time. This will enhance the GPU’s ability to quickly access data, resulting in improved performance.
MSI Afterburner also allows you to adjust power limits, fan speeds, and voltage settings, offering even more control over your GPU’s performance. However, it’s crucial to exercise caution and monitor temperatures closely to prevent overheating or damaging your hardware.
By skillfully overclocking your GPU using MSI Afterburner, you can maximize its power and enjoy smoother gaming experiences and faster graphics rendering.
